Frequency Modification Plan for Communication Base Station Energy Storage System
This paper proposes a control strategy for flexibly participating in power system frequency regulation using the energy storage of 5G base station. Firstly, the potential ability of energy storage in base station is analyzed from the structure and energy flow.

The protection of GSM and base station towers from lightning and overvoltage is provided by integrating external lightning systems, internal lightning systems, earthing, equipotential bonding and LV surge arrester protection techniques within the framework of IEC-62305 standard. Deployment of LTE base station equipment and establishment of communication links
LTE deployment refers to the implementation of LTE network infrastructure to provide high-speed mobile internet services. This checklist ensures that all critical steps, from site survey to final deployment, are meticulously planned and executed. LTE base stations are the backbone of. . Site Planning and Design: This phase involves assessing the need for a new mobile site, selecting a suitable location, and designing the layout of the infrastructure.
